Water Extraction Service: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No Easy to clean up and contains no standing water.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ract water and prevent further damage.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Hidden moisture can cause mold growth and further damage.
Leaky roof with water damage No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ract water and repair roof damage.
Basement flood with sewage backup No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to clean up and disinfect the area.
Hidden water damage behind walls No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and extract water.

Water Extraction Service Cost in the 48380 Area

The cost of water extraction in the 48380 area can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ices start at $500 for small jobs and can go up to $2,500 or more for larger-scale water extraction.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, number of drying units needed, and equipment rental costs.
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, number of sensors needed, and equipment rental costs.
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of sewage, and equipment needed.
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Hidden Water Damage Detection $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, number of sensors needed, and equipment rental costs.
